Compact Sales Tracker Template for Client Reporting

Purpose: This Excel template is specifically designed for Client Reporting, providing a streamlined and professional method to monitor, analyze, and present sales performance data. It enables sales managers and account executives to deliver accurate, consistent, and visually engaging reports to clients with minimal effort.

Template Type: Sales Tracker — A dynamic system for recording daily or weekly sales activities, tracking key performance indicators (KPIs), monitoring pipeline progression, and forecasting future revenue.

Style/Version: Compact — Optimized for clarity and efficiency with minimal visual clutter. The layout is designed to fit essential information in a space-efficient manner while maintaining readability. All data is organized into a single, focused workbook to reduce navigation complexity.

Sheet Names

  1. Sales Log: The core tracking sheet containing all raw sales data and activities.
  2. KPI Dashboard: A compact summary view of key metrics using visual indicators, sparklines, and conditional formatting.
  3. Client Overview: A consolidated view per client with performance highlights, trend lines, and activity summaries.
  4. Template Guide: (Hidden or password-protected) Contains instructions and formula explanations for reference only.

Table Structures & Data Organization

All tables are designed as Excel Tables (using Ctrl+T) to enable dynamic filtering, structured references, and auto-expansion of data rows.

1. Sales Log (Main Tracking Table)

Column Data Type Description
Entry Date Date (YYYY-MM-DD) Timestamp for the activity.
Client Name Text (String) Name of the client or organization.
Sales Rep Text (Dropdown List) List of authorized sales team members for selection.
Deal Stage Text (Dropdown: Prospecting, Qualification, Proposal, Negotiation, Closed-Won, Closed-Lost) Status of the sales pipeline.
Deal Size ($) Number (Currency Format) Estimated or actual value of the deal.
Closed Date Date (Optional, blank if not closed) Date when the deal was finalized.
Status Text (Calculated: "Open", "Won", "Lost") Dynamically determined based on Deal Stage.

2. KPI Dashboard (Compact Summary)

This sheet contains a concise, at-a-glance view of performance metrics:

  • Total Deals Open: Counts entries where Status ≠ "Won" or "Lost"
  • Total Revenue Forecasted: SUM of Deal Size for all open deals
  • Win Rate (%): (Closed-Won / Total Closed) × 100
  • Average Deal Size: AVERAGE of Deal Size for closed deals
  • Last 30-Day Activity: Sparkline showing daily deal entries over the past month

3. Client Overview (Per-Client Summary)

A dynamic table that groups data by Client Name, summarizing:

  • Total number of active deals per client
  • Sum of deal sizes for open and closed deals
  • Last activity date with the client
  • Current status trend (e.g., "Growing", "Stable", "Declining") using conditional formatting icons

Conditional Formatting

Enhances visual clarity and quick insight:

  • Deal Stage Column (Sales Log): Color-coded based on stage using rules:
    • Prospecting → Light Blue
    • Qualification → Yellow
    • Proposal → Light Green
    • Negotiation → Light Orange
    • Closed-Won → Green
    • Closed-Lost → Light Red
  • KPI Dashboard: Use data bars for revenue forecast, color scales for win rate (green > 80%, yellow 60–79%, red < 60%)
  • Client Overview: Icon sets to show trend direction: ↑ (Growing), → (Stable), ↓ (Declining)

User Instructions

To use this template effectively:

  1. Populate the Sales Log: Enter data row by row with accurate dates, client names, deal stages, and values.
  2. Use Dropdowns: Leverage the pre-configured data validation in "Sales Rep" and "Deal Stage" columns to ensure consistency.
  3. Synchronize Data: All dashboards update automatically as new entries are made. No manual refresh needed (if enabled).
  4. Export Reports: Use the 'Client Overview' sheet to generate client-specific PDFs or export for email reporting.
  5. Audit Trail: The template supports version tracking via Excel’s built-in "Version History" feature.
